Brine-Soaked and Dried French Prunes from Germany
French prunes, typically from the Prunus domestica variety, undergo brine soaking to rehydrate and preserve before controlled drying, yielding tender prunes ideal for baking and cooking. Classified under HTS 0813.20.10.00 due to the specific dual process of brine treatment followed by drying, as per chapter notes on provisional preservation. This method ensures they are not ready for direct consumption.

Import Tips
• Provide lab analysis proving brine soaking process to avoid reclassification as standard dried prunes
• Label with full processing details and net weight excluding brine residue for accurate duty assessment
• Ensure compliance with AQIM requirements for dried fruits; test for contaminants like ochratoxin A common in prunes
